Simukonda Fired

[Zambia Reports] THE Football Association of Zambia (FAZ) has relieved under-23 national team coach Fighton Simukonda of his duties following the disastrous outing to the Senegal African Under-23 Championship.

UPND Official Admits Copperbelt Still PF Stronghold

[Zambia Reports] The ground on the Copperbelt is fertile but we are failing to cultivate it, a United Party for National Development (UPND) official has told Zambia Reports in Kitwe.

Ex-Ps Testifies Against Masebo

[Zambia Reports] Former Tourism Minister Sylvia Masebo had a torrid time in court when his former Permanent Secretary Charity Mwansa testified against her in her abuse of authority court.

Corruption Has Increased in Zambia

[Zambian Watchdog] Increasing corruption is wreaking havoc on the Zambian economy, as the payment of bribes has reached the level of 78 percent in 2014, according to research by Transparency International.
